WPF Debugger Visualizer

While debugging a WPF I came across a great debugger visualizer: WoodStock. WoodStock gives you a treeview of the current Visual Tree of a given element. So when you debug, you can select a framework element and show the tree like this:

It then shows a tree similar to this tree:

Great stuff when debugging a WPF app!
